Erik ten Hag has landed in London as his Manchester United revolution gathers pace.
Legendary former Wales, Wrexham and Manchester United star Mickey Thomas is set to take on Wales' highest mountain to raise money for Upper G.I. Surgical Unit at Wrexham Maelor Hospital. The 67-year-old will climb Yr Wyddfa/Snowdon on June 18 alongside the surgeon who saved his life.
Jose Mourinho has suggested Manchester United are not expected to win trophies and that the expectations placed on him to win silverware – both at Old Trafford and Tottenham – were unrealistic.
